Title: The Opinions of Primary Teacher Candidates towards Evaluation Performances of Instructors
Authors: Sural, Serhat
Keywords: Performance evaluation; Primary teacher; Teaching courses
Publisher: IJATE-INT JOURNAL ASSESSMENT TOOLS EDUCATION
Abstract: The knowledge and experience gained in the higher education stage with professional instructors who are one of the most important elements of the process for the individual. Because of this, the instructor of the class teacher education courses within the program, course performance, it is intended that teachers have taken the course evaluation by the instructor.
General screening model is used in the conduct of the trial, and the study was designed with a descriptive survey method. The class teachers constitute 203 teachers. In order to evaluate the performance of teaching staff "Teacher Performance Assessment" inventory developed by Dalgic (2010) is used.
Despite teacher candidates applied to the inventory offered as an option to evaluate all training courses, they prefer to evaluate training courses they take in life science teaching evaluation, teaching social studies, science and technology education and mathematics education courses.
